Center for Good Governance(CGG), Hyderabad has entered into MoU with National Institute of Electronics and Information Technology (NIELIT), Delhi to provide support in pre examination process towards receipt of application, fees (online mode) reconciliation of fees, allocation of centres and online dispatch of admit cards / hall tickets etc. for direct recruitment to various posts in DeitY and its associated organizations."

A national level seminar on “Decentralised Governance in Water and Sanitation in Rural India” was organised by the National Institute of Administrative Research (NIAR), Lal Bahadur Shastri National Academy of Administration (LBSNAA), Mussoorie from 26th to 28th June 2012.
Andhra Pradesh Information Commission and Centre for Good Governance (CGG) have organized a Familiarization Programme on Right to Information Act for the newly appointed Information Commissioners
Comprehensive History & Culture of Andhra Pradesh Website Lanuched on 21st April, 2012 by Dr. P.V. Parahbrahma Sastry, eminent Epigraphist and former deputy director of Dept. of Archaeology and Museums.
Right To Information (RTI) Clinic has been inaugurated at the MRO office, Sheikhpet Mandal of Hyderabad district, AP. It was inaugurated by Ms. Minnie Mathew, IAS, Spl.Chief Secretary to the Government, GA (GPM&AR), Govt of Andhra Pradesh on 28th February 2012.

EENADU-Telugu News daily featured an article on the Agriculture Governance Cell (Agriculture Resource Group)on September 11, 2011. The article contained factual errors. Hence CGG issued a Clarification to EENADU, consequent to which the latter published a Correction in its September 13, 2011 edition.
